We handle all popular dishwasher setups:
Freestanding Dishwashers – We fix cycle faults, drainage issues, leaks, and power problems.
Built-in / Integrated Dishwashers – Concealed dishwashers repaired for door faults, panel issues, and control failures.
Drawer Dishwashers – We service modern drawer models (including Fisher & Paykel).
Slimline Dishwashers – Compact units repaired for overflows, pressure issues, and more.
Commercial Dishwashers – Fast, reliable repairs for restaurants, hotels, and corporate kitchens.
